1. What is a Marketing Analytics Specialist at Teramind?

The Marketing Analytics Specialist at Teramind serves as a critical bridge between data-driven insights and strategic market growth. In an organization focused on employee monitoring, data loss prevention, and user behavior analytics, your role is to translate complex performance metrics into actionable narratives that inform product positioning and customer acquisition strategies.

You will be tasked with analyzing the efficacy of marketing campaigns, optimizing conversion funnels, and providing the visibility necessary for leadership to make high-stakes, data-backed decisions. This role is not just about reporting numbers; it is about understanding the "why" behind the data to help Teramind maintain its competitive edge in the cybersecurity and productivity software space. You will work in a fast-paced environment where your ability to synthesize technical data for non-technical stakeholders is highly valued.

4. Interview Process Overview

The interview process at Teramind is designed to evaluate both your technical capability and your cultural alignment with the team. Candidates typically progress from an initial screening with a recruiter to interviews with direct management and, eventually, senior leadership. The process is intended to gauge your ability to think critically about marketing impact and your potential to contribute to the company's growth.

6. Key Responsibilities

As a Marketing Analytics Specialist, your primary responsibility is to provide the intelligence that drives marketing efficiency. You will spend your day auditing campaign performance, tracking traffic sources, and identifying friction points in the conversion funnel.

Collaboration is essential. You will work closely with the product marketing team to ensure that messaging is hitting the right audience. You will also provide regular briefings to leadership, which requires a high degree of precision and the ability to defend your data-driven conclusions under scrutiny. Expect to own the analytical stack and to be the primary point of contact for marketing performance questions.

7. Role Requirements & Qualifications

A competitive candidate for this role should possess a blend of technical capability and business maturity.

  • Must-have skills: Expertise in marketing analytics tools, proficiency in data visualization, and a proven track record of managing end-to-end marketing reporting.
  • Nice-to-have skills: Experience within the cybersecurity or SaaS industry, familiarity with CRM integration, and advanced SQL or data modeling skills.
  • Soft skills: High emotional intelligence, the ability to communicate technical data to non-technical leaders, and the resilience to handle ambiguous project requirements.
